We are looking for a Senior AI Engineer to design, build and scale our next-generation AI and Large Language Model (LLM) applications. In this role, you will lead the technical development of advanced AI workflows, work directly with clients to turn their ideas into reality and help mentor our growing team.
Responsibilities
- Architect and implement scalable AI applications, including chatbots, search platforms and autonomous agent workflows
- Collaborate directly with business stakeholders to understand their challenges and recommend smart, LLM-driven solutions
- Creation of data pipelines, design of smart prompt strategies and development of testing frameworks to ensure AI models are safe, accurate and cost-effective
- Establish coding standards, perform code reviews and mentor junior developers in AI best practices
- Run quick experiments and build prototypes to test new models
- Stay ahead of the curve with emerging AI research and tools
Requirements
- 3+ years of proven background as a Senior Software Engineer delivering production-grade AI, Machine Learning or LLM-based solutions
- Proficiency in Python (especially web frameworks like FastAPI) and understanding of NLP concepts (semantic similarity, tokenization, text classification)
- Hands-on expertise in modern AI patterns, particularly RAG (Retrieval-Augmented Generation) and AI Agents
- Familiarity with major LLM APIs (OpenAI, Anthropic, Bedrock) and framework tools (LangGraph, LlamaIndex)
- Background in deploying AI applications at scale, managing cloud costs and evaluating model quality (retrieval metrics, LLM-based evaluation)
- Capability to quickly spin up user interfaces using Streamlit, Gradio or similar tools
- Skills in explaining complex technical ideas clearly to both developer teams and non-technical clients
- English proficiency at B2 level or higher
Nice to have
- Development experience with TypeScript
- Experience incorporating AI into the SDLC (GitHub Copilot, Cursor)
- Expertise in AWS or Azure (specifically Azure OpenAI or AWS Bedrock)
- Familiarity with Databricks (MLflow, AgentBricks) for data or model workflows
- Knowledge of advanced search/retrieval systems (vector databases, semantic search, rerankers)
- Understanding of emerging open-source protocols (Model Context Protocol - MCP) or LLM monitoring tools (LangSmith, Arize Phoenix)
We offer
- CONTINUOUS UPSKILLING, LEARNING \& DEVELOPMENT
- Diversity of assignments and projects
- Personal development plan
- Mentoring programs and leadership development
- Certification and professional development support
- Access to learning platforms including more than 2,500 internal courses and the Eurostaffs Learning library with 20,000+ courses
- English courses taught by certified teachers
- CORPORATE BENEFITS
- Extra leave days
- Referral bonuses
- COMPENSATION PACKAGE
- Competitive compensation paid in USD
- Regular salary and performance reviews
- MEDICAL \& HEALTHCARE
- WORKING ENVIRONMENT
- Recreation office zones with tea, coffee and snacks
- Sports and game consoles
- IT equipment and Microsoft's Software Assurance Home Use Program (HUP)
Please note that our Talent Attraction Team reviews applications and CVs submitted in English.
EPAM is a global leader in AI transformation engineering and integrated consulting, serving Forbes Global 2000 companies and ambitious startups. We deliver globally and engage locally, making the future real for clients, partners, and employees. We are proud to be recognised by Forbes, Eurostaffs, Newsweek, Time Magazine, Great Place to Work and kununu as a Most Loved Workplace around the world.